build an app like zomato
Build App Like Zomato
Building an app like Zomato can be an exciting and lucrative endeavor, especially in today’s era where food delivery and restaurant discovery apps have become integral to daily life. Zomato, a pioneer in this domain, has set a benchmark with its robust features and user-friendly design. If you’re planning to build an app like Zomato, here’s a comprehensive guide to help you get started.
Understanding the Basics of Zomato
Zomato is a multifaceted platform that combines restaurant discovery, food delivery, and customer reviews. Its success lies in its seamless user experience and the value it provides to customers, restaurants, and delivery partners. To build an app like Zomato, you need to incorporate similar features while adding your unique value proposition to stand out in the competitive market.
Key Features to Include in an App Like Zomato
1. User Interface and Experience (UI/UX):
The app’s design should be intuitive, visually appealing, and easy to navigate. A well-designed interface ensures that users can effortlessly search for restaurants, place orders, and leave reviews.
2. Restaurant Listings:
Your app should include a comprehensive database of restaurants with details like menus, photos, contact information, and ratings. Filters for cuisine type, location, price range, and popularity will enhance the user experience.
3. Food Delivery Integration:
An efficient delivery system is crucial. Integrate real-time tracking, delivery time estimates, and multiple payment options to offer a seamless experience.
4. Reviews and Ratings:
Allow users to share their dining experiences by leaving reviews and ratings. This fosters trust and helps new users make informed decisions.
5. Search and Filters:
Implement advanced search algorithms and filters to make it easier for users to find restaurants based on their preferences.
6. Loyalty Programs and Discounts:
Introduce reward systems, discounts, and promotional offers to attract and retain customers.
7. Customer Support:
Provide efficient customer support through chatbots, FAQs, and live assistance to address user queries and complaints.
Steps to Build an App Like Zomato
1. Market Research:
Conduct thorough research to understand your target audience, competitors, and market trends. Identify the gaps in existing food delivery apps and plan how your app can fill those gaps.
2. Define Your Unique Selling Proposition (USP):
Determine what will set your app apart. This could be faster delivery times, exclusive restaurant partnerships, or unique features like AR-based menu previews.
3. Choose the Right Technology Stack:
Select a robust technology stack for your app’s front-end, back-end, and database. Popular options include:
Front-end: React Native, Flutter
Back-end: Node.js, Django
Database: MySQL, MongoDB
4. Hire a Development Team:
Collaborate with experienced developers who understand the nuances of building food delivery apps. You may need UI/UX designers, front-end and back-end developers, and quality assurance testers.
5. Design the User Interface:
Create wireframes and prototypes to visualize the app’s design. Focus on a user-centric approach to ensure your app is visually appealing and easy to use.
6. Develop Core Features:
Start with the essential features like restaurant listings, user accounts, and order management. Gradually add advanced features like AI-driven recommendations and voice search.
7. Test Thoroughly:
Conduct rigorous testing to identify and fix bugs. Ensure the app performs seamlessly across different devices and operating systems.
8. Launch and Market Your App:
Once your app is ready, launch it on major app stores like Google Play and Apple App Store. Use digital marketing strategies such as social media ads, influencer collaborations, and content marketing to promote your app.
Monetizing Your App
Building an app like Zomato opens up multiple revenue streams, such as:
Commission Fees: Charge restaurants a commission for every order placed through your app.
Subscription Plans: Offer premium plans for users and restaurants with exclusive benefits.
Advertisements: Allow restaurants to run paid promotions on your platform.
Delivery Charges: Earn through delivery fees for food orders.
Challenges and How to Overcome Them
Building an app like Zomato comes with challenges such as high competition, technical complexities, and operational logistics. Here’s how to tackle them:
Competition: Focus on your USP and continuously innovate to stay ahead.
Technical Issues: Hire skilled developers and invest in high-quality infrastructure.
Logistics: Partner with reliable delivery services or build an in-house delivery team.
Conclusion
To build an app like Zomato, you need a combination of innovative ideas, technical expertise, and a customer-centric approach. Start by understanding the market, define your goals, and execute them with precision. By offering a seamless and engaging experience, you can carve a niche in the thriving food delivery industry. With dedication and the right strategies, your app can become a go-to platform for food lovers worldwide.

Comments
Post a Comment